MEXICAN BANDITS.

HOLD AMERICANS FOR RANSOM. By Telegraph.—Press Amu.—Copyright. Washington, June 27. The State Department has been advised that 40 Americans have been captured by Mexican bandits near Tampico and held for ransom. The Cortez Oil Company’s property has also been seized. ' The Secretary of State (Mr. C. E. Hughes) made a strong demand that the Mexican Government should act immediately to suppress banditary, secure the release of the Americans and recapture the property.
